Nyelvtanra is a form in Hungarian formed from the noun nyelvtan (grammar) plus the directional suffix -ra. In Hungarian, the suffix -ra/-re attaches to nouns to indicate movement toward a place, a goal, or a target of an action. When combined with nyelvtan, nyelvtanra can mark a target or focus related to grammar. It is not a standalone lexical item with a fixed meaning, but a morphologically composed form used in phrases where grammar functions as the domain, field, or object of reference.
